World Elder Abuse Awareness Day (WEAAD) is commemorated each year on June 15th to highlight one of the worst manifestations of ageism and inequality in society, elder abuse. WEAAD was officially recognized by the United Nations General Assembly in December 2011, following a request by the International Network for the Prevention of Elder Abuse, who first established the commemoration in June 2006.
Elder abuse can be financial, emotional, physical, and sexual. It also includes people who are neglected and those who neglect themselves. Social isolation, financial or emotional stress, and dementia can make a senior vulnerable to abuse.
The consequences of elder abuse are grave: older adults who are abused are twice as likely to be hospitalized, four times as likely to go into nursing homes, and three times as likely to die. While studies show that 60% of abusers are family members, abuse can happen in any setting: in the adult’s own home or a senior living community.
